Description

The uMshwathi Municipality invites bids for the supply, installation, commissioning, and maintenance of an integrated Human Resources and Payroll system. This includes Time and Attendance control and an Employee Self-Service solution. The project will take place at the uMshwathi Municipal Offices over a 36-month period. Key deliverables include a fully functional payroll and HR management system that integrates with the existing Phoenix ERP, financial ledgers, and banking systems. The solution must support all municipal staff, including permanent and contract employees. Bidders must provide a detailed work plan, training plan, and support strategy. The system must ensure data security, role-based access, and compliance with municipal staff regulations and MSCOA standards. The closing date for this tender is 10 July 2026.
